首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Filezilla If语句

Filezilla If语句
EN

Stack Overflow用户
提问于 2014-03-29 04:05:35
回答 1查看 54关注 0票数 0

在我发布的批处理文件片段中,我遇到了一个问题,我需要使用filezilla和命令行来确保调度脚本不会失去连接。我的尝试是使用if语句来验证远程服务器上是否存在文件夹,目标是如果没有连接,文件就找不到了,程序就会立即退出。当前的批处理文件不会这样做,相反,它会继续,并可能最终删除文件,无论它们是否已经修复。任何关于此文件或实现相同功能的替代方法的建议都将不胜感激。

代码语言:javascript
复制
open xx.xx.xx.xx<br>
xxxxxxxx<br>
xxxxxxxx<br>
cd xxxxx<br>
! if exist xx.xx.xx.xx/xxxxxx/ (<br>
    mput *.mp4<br> 
)
! if not exist xx.xx.xx.xx/xxxxxxx (<br>
    close<br> 
)

! del *.mp4<br>
quit<br>
exit
EN

回答 1

Stack Overflow用户

发布于 2014-03-29 10:34:08

在批处理命令中:

代码语言:javascript
复制
ping -n 1 ftp.server.com >nul || echo server is not responding
票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/22722223

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档